Met Office Forecasts Continued Heatwave in England and Wales Next Week
11 Temmuz 2026The Guardian
- The Met Office has announced that the heatwave conditions affecting England and Wales will persist into next week, with temperatures expected to remain above 30C. This prolonged period of high temperatures has prompted warnings of wildfires and heat health alerts in certain regions.
- Residents are advised to take precautions as the scorching weather continues.
- Heatwaves have become more common in recent years, raising concerns about their impact on health, agriculture, and the environment. The Met Office's warnings serve as a reminder of the need for preparedness in the face of climate-related challenges.
- The ongoing heatwave highlights the increasing frequency of extreme weather events, which may be attributed to climate change. As temperatures soar, the potential for wildfires poses significant risks to both the environment and public health.
